Output 51017f63dc1ef24ba4c89636619357cc7f7d787a7a6ebea9425f496a1f9aa418:0

value
1037613
script pubkey
OP_0 OP_PUSHBYTES_20 6f648790cc66b0790c4d2214e8a2bc759e21441f
address
bc1qdajg0yxvv6c8jrzdyg2w3g4uwk0zz3qlhkp2v5
transaction
51017f63dc1ef24ba4c89636619357cc7f7d787a7a6ebea9425f496a1f9aa418
spent
true